Electrolysis System CHLORINSITU IIa 60 – 2,500 g/h

Output 60 – 2,500 g/h of chlorine

CHLORINSITU IIa is a compact on-site electrolysis system for the production of a low-chlorate hypochlorite solution from salt and electricity. Key advantages are its simple process management and excellent system safety through integrated ventilation and bleeding.

Product description

Enhanced efficiency through innovative design.

The CHLORINSITU IIa product range combines the proven and durable design of the undivided electrolysis Chlorine and sodium hydroxide are produced in-situ in electrolysis by passing an electric ... more in the glossary cell with an innovative design. An exceptional quality of hypochlorite solution is achieved when the salt and power output is increased. The chlorate content of the product is below the limit value specified in EN 901.

The electrolysis Chlorine and sodium hydroxide are produced in-situ in electrolysis by passing an electric ... more in the glossary system is perfectly equipped for all safe water disinfection with a capacity of up to 2500 g of chlorine per hour.

All relevant system components are accommodated in a space-saving housing. Integrated hydrogen drainage enables the system to be installed without any need for additional ventilation.

The softener and a 50-litre product tank are installed in the system housing with systems up to 300 g/h. An integrated metering pump circulates the chlorine from the tank directly to the application or into a larger storage tank.

An H2 deaerator dissolves the hydrogen directly from the hypochlorite with systems above 625 g/h. The hydrogen-free product is pumped by an integrated pump into an external product tank. The product pump is also capable of pumping across height differences of up to 7 m. Customised metering stations supply the points of injection.

The external product storage tank does not require additional hydrogen bleeding. There are therefore no additional costs relating to installation and operation.

The system is immediately ready for use, thanks to its plug-and-play concept. Operation of the electrolysis Chlorine and sodium hydroxide are produced in-situ in electrolysis by passing an electric ... more in the glossary system has been consciously kept simple.

    All figures apply for 20 °C ambient temperature and 15 °C feed water. The performance of the system is affected by the temperature and quality of the water and salt.

    Salt usage:3.0 kg/kg chlorine
    Energy efficiency:4.0 kWh/kg chlorine
    Product concentration:9 g/l (0.9 % ±0.05) chlorine
    pH value of product (approx.):9.5
    Salt specifications:CHLORINSITU salt, salt tablets or salt with a grain size of ≥ 6 mm, min. 99.4 % NaCl, max. 0.05 % insoluble substances, max. 10 mg/kg iron, max. 10 mg/kg manganese, max. 100 mg/kg calcium + magnesium
    Inlet water temperature:10...25 °C (lower/higher temperatures require a heater/chiller)
    Water supply:2 bar < pressure < 6 bar (drinking water quality)
    Ambient conditions:Non-condensing, non-corrosive and dust-free ambient air in the installation room
    Permissible relative air humidity:Max. 85 %
    Permissible ambient temperature:10...40 °C
